Abstract

The invention relates to a device for an oil field well, in particular to a continuous oil-pumping pipe device. The technical scheme is that the continuous oil-pumping pipe device is mainly composed of an injection head, a roller, a continuous oil pipe, an anti-spraying pipe, a blowout preventer, an oil well opening, sleeve pipes, an oil pipe and a packer. One end of the injection head is connected with the continuous oil pipe, the other end of the injection head is connected with the anti-spraying pipe, the continuous oil pipe is wound on the roller, the anti-spraying pipe is connected to the oil well opening through the blowout preventer, the oil well opening is connected with the oil pipe, and the sleeve pipes are arranged on the outer side of the oil pipe and connected through the packer. The continuous oil-pumping pipe device has the advantages that the hydraulically powered well repairing device can be used on an offshore work platform and a land oil field and can replace an ordinary well repairing device and a steel wire operation device to perform well repair, well completion and steel wire operation, cement remaining in the sleeve pipes can be circulated after extrusion, a well depth channel is rebuilt, the production cost is reduced, and working efficiency of well repair operation is improved.

Description

Continuous oil well tubing device
Technical field
The present invention relates to a kind of oil well equipment, particularly a kind of continuous oil well tubing device.
Background technology
In the field produces, need regularly oil field equipment to be keeped in repair, need in the oilfield exploitation oil well is carried out remedial cementing work, legacy equipment is stayed the cement in the sleeve pipe, can't utilize, also need cleaning, cause cost of production to improve, reduced the production efficiency in oil field.
Summary of the invention
Purpose of the present invention is exactly in view of the foregoing defects the prior art has, and a kind of continuous oil well tubing device is provided.
Its technical scheme is: mainly be comprised of injection head, cylinder, coiled tubing, lubricator, preventer, oil well mouth, sleeve pipe, oil pipe, packer, one end of injection head connects coiled tubing, the other end connects lubricator, described coiled tubing is wrapped on the cylinder, described lubricator connects the oil well mouth by preventer, oil well mouth connected pipes, the outside of described oil pipe is provided with sleeve pipe, connects by packer between the sleeve pipe.
Above-mentioned oil pipe is provided with ball-and-seat, locator and hydraulic pressure release.
The invention has the beneficial effects as follows: by hydraulically powered workover rig, can be used for offshore work platform and oil field, land, can replace general workover rig and steel wire operation equipment to carry out well workover, completion and steel wire operation, the cement of staying in the sleeve pipe can circulate after extruding, rebuild the well depth passage, Decrease production cost improves the operating efficiency of workover treatment.
Description of drawings:
Accompanying drawing 1 is structural representation of the present invention;
Among the upper figure: injection head 1, cylinder 2, coiled tubing 3, operation room 4, lubricator 5, preventer 6, oil well mouth 7, sleeve pipe 8, oil pipe 9, packer 10, ball-and-seat 11, locator 12, hydraulic pressure release 13.
The specific embodiment:
By reference to the accompanying drawings 1, the invention will be further described:
The present invention mainly is comprised of injection head 1, cylinder 2, coiled tubing 3, lubricator 5, preventer 6, oil well mouth 7, sleeve pipe 8, oil pipe 9, packer 10, ball-and-seat 11, locator 12, hydraulic pressure release 13, one end of injection head 1 connects coiled tubing 3, the other end connects lubricator 5, described coiled tubing 3 is wrapped on the cylinder 2, described lubricator 5 connects oil well mouth 7 by preventer 6, oil well mouth 7 connected pipes 9, the outside of described oil pipe 9 is provided with sleeve pipe 8, connects by packer 10 between the sleeve pipe 8; Described oil pipe 9 is provided with ball-and-seat 11, locator 12 and hydraulic pressure release 13.
Pass through the operation room 4 interior operations in working vehicle during use, carry out transferring of coiled tubing, by hydraulically powered workover rig, can be used for offshore work platform and oil field, land, can replace general workover rig and steel wire operation equipment to carry out well workover, completion and steel wire operation, the cement of staying in the sleeve pipe can circulate after extruding, rebuilds the well depth passage, Decrease production cost improves the operating efficiency of workover treatment.
